BMW Introduces Dynamic Damping Control Suspension System

Mon, 04 Jul 2011

BMW has developed new suspension technology that automatically adjusts damping for different riding conditions. The Dynamic Damping Control is the next evolutionary step in BMW‘s suspension technology, following its Electronic Suspension Adjustment systems (ESA and ESA II). While ESA allowed the rider to adjust suspension settings with the push of a button, DDC automatically makes adjustments as you ride.
